ad9914 源代码
时间: 2024-01-21 19:00:54 浏览: 40
AD9914 是一款集成了数模转换器(DAC)和直接数字频率合成器(DDS)功能的芯片。它可以广泛应用于无线电通信、雷达、医疗成像以及测试测量等领域。
AD9914 的源代码可以通过ADI(Analog Devices Inc.)官方网站获取。源代码包括初始化代码和使用代码两部分。初始化代码用于设置AD9914的寄存器,包括频率、相位和幅度等参数的配置。使用代码则是根据具体的需求来操作AD9914,例如设定输出信号频率、启用或禁用调制功能等。
在使用AD9914的源代码时,需要先将源代码下载到开发板或计算机上。然后,根据开发板的硬件结构和引脚连接情况,进行适当的配置。接下来,通过调用相关函数或命令来设置AD9914的寄存器和参数。最后,通过相应的引脚将AD9914与其他设备连接起来,实现所需的功能。
AD9914的源代码提供了灵活性和可定制性,可以根据具体的应用需求进行修改。可以通过调整参数设置来改变输出信号的频率、幅度和相位等特性。同时,源代码还提供了一些附加功能,如线性和非线性频率调制、幅度调制、脉冲生成等。通过灵活使用源代码,可以实现更多复杂的应用。
总之,AD9914的源代码为开发者提供了方便而强大的功能,使其能够快速而灵活地使用AD9914芯片,满足不同领域的需求。
相关问题
ad9517配置源代码
ad9517是一款精密时钟发生器芯片,一般用于高性能时钟和数据转换应用中。配置ad9517源代码的步骤如下:
1. 下载AD9517的数据手册和编程软件。首先需要从ADI官方网站下载AD9517的数据手册和编程软件。数据手册中包含了AD9517的寄存器配置信息,而编程软件则可以帮助用户生成相应的源代码。
2. 确定时钟分频比和输出频率。在配置AD9517源代码之前,需要明确芯片的时钟分频比和所需的输出频率。根据实际应用需求,确定每个输出通道的分频比和输出频率。
3. 使用编程软件生成源代码。打开AD9517的编程软件,根据所需的时钟分频比和输出频率,输入相关参数。编程软件会根据输入的参数生成对应的寄存器配置信息,即生成源代码。
4. 上传源代码至目标设备。将生成的源代码上传至目标设备,如FPGA、微控制器或其他集成电路中。通过上传源代码,AD9517会按照预设的配置参数来运行,生成相应的时钟信号。
5. 调试和验证。上传源代码后,需要对AD9517进行调试和验证。可以通过读取AD9517的状态寄存器来确认配置是否正确,同时可以通过示波器或频谱仪来验证输出的时钟信号是否符合预期。
总之,配置AD9517的源代码需要首先了解其数据手册和编程软件,确定时钟分频比和输出频率,使用编程软件生成源代码,然后上传至目标设备并进行调试和验证。只有经过严格的配置和验证,才能确保AD9517在实际应用中正常工作。
ad9959源代码+资料+原理图
AD9959是一款由ADI公司生产的高性能数字信号发生器芯片,可广泛应用于通信、测量、医疗、雷达和无线电等领域。该芯片集成了高速DAC、频率合成器和相位发生器,具有很高的频率和相位分辨率。
AD9959的源代码是指用于控制该芯片的软件代码。通过编写源代码,可以实现对AD9959的各种设置和功能操作。这些代码可以由工程师根据具体应用需求进行编写,例如设置输出频率、相位和幅度控制等。
AD9959的资料是指关于该芯片的技术文档和说明书。这些资料可以提供关于AD9959的技术参数、功能特性、引脚定义、寄存器设置和编程指令等详细信息。通过仔细阅读和理解这些资料,可以更好地了解和使用AD9959芯片。
AD9959的原理图是指使用该芯片设计的电路图。原理图包括芯片与外部电路的连接方式和信号传输路径等信息,可以帮助工程师进行电路设计和布局。原理图也提供了关于外部元件的选型和连接方法等指导,以确保电路能够正确地工作。
总之,AD9959源代码、资料和原理图分别是用于控制和应用AD9959芯片的软件代码、技术文档和电路设计图。这些资源对于工程师来说非常重要,可以帮助他们更好地了解和使用AD9959芯片,实现各种应用需求。